Abstract
This paper considers a leader-follower type formation control problem under drop out of vehicle. In our approach, when in-degree of vehicles corresponding to follower vehicles is changed due to the drop out, a desired formation pattern is maintained so that relative distance between other vehicles can be kept constant. Simulation results show the effectiveness of the proposed approach.
